If it's cash back you're just giving them a interest free loan.
Cash it out and put it savings or respend it.
If Cash back it's always better to deposit to your account if possible instead of a statement credit.
Let's say you spend 100 and get 5% back (5 dollars).
If you credit statement it's only worth 5 dollars, but if you direct deposit it and spend it again it's worth 5 dollars plus another 5% of 5 dollars. So $5.25.
